Evidence-Based Practice in Nursing & Healthcare: A Guide to Best Practice, 4th Edition
Bernadette Mazurek Melnyk, PhD, RN, APRN-CNP, FAANP, FNAP, FAAN and Ellen Fineout-Overholt, PhD, RN, FNAP, FAAN

Enhance your clinical decision-making capabilities and improve patient outcomes through evidence-based practice.

Develop the skills and knowledge you need to make evidence-based practice (EBP) an integral part of your clinical decision-making and everyday nursing practice with this proven, approachable text. Written in a straightforward, conversational style, Evidence-Based Practice in Nursing & Healthcare delivers real-world examples and meaningful strategies in every chapter to help you confidently meet today’s clinical challenges and ensure positive patient outcomes.


• NEW! Making Connections: An EBP Exemplar opens each unit, immersing you in an unfolding case study of EBP in real-life practice.
• NEW! Chapters reflect the most current implications of EBP on health policy and the context, content, and outcomes of implementing EBP competencies in clinical and academic settings.
• NEW! Learning objectives and EBP Terms to Learn at both the unit and chapter levels help you study efficiently and stay focused on essential concepts and vocabulary.
• Making EBP Real features continue to end each unit with real-world examples that demonstrate the principles of EBP applied.
• EBP Fast Facts reinforce key points at a glance.
• Clinical Scenarios clarify the EBP process and enhance your rapid appraisal capabilities.
